powder additives play a crucial role in various industries, offering a wide range of benefits such as improved strength, durability, and resistance to environmental factors. These additives are finely powdered substances that are mixed with base materials to enhance their properties. From construction to manufacturing, powder additives are utilized in diverse applications to optimize performance and meet specific requirements.
One of the key advantages of using powder additives is their ability to enhance the strength and durability of materials. By adding these fine particles to a base material, such as concrete or plastic, the overall structural integrity can be significantly improved. For example, in the construction industry, powder additives are commonly used in concrete mixes to increase compressive strength and reduce permeability. This results in more durable structures that can withstand harsh weather conditions and heavy loads.
Moreover, powder additives can also enhance the resistance of materials to environmental factors such as corrosion, abrasion, and UV radiation. By incorporating these additives into coatings, paints, and plastics, manufacturers can create products that have a longer lifespan and require less maintenance. For instance, in the automotive industry, powder additives are often added to paint formulations to improve scratch resistance and color retention, resulting in vehicles that look newer for longer periods.
In addition to improving strength and durability, powder additives can also enhance the performance of materials in specific applications. For example, in the pharmaceutical industry, powder additives are used in tablet formulations to improve the flow properties of powders, making it easier to compress them into tablets. Similarly, in the food industry, powder additives are added to food products to enhance texture, stability, and shelf life.
Furthermore, powder additives can also be used to modify the conductivity, thermal properties, or appearance of materials. In electronics manufacturing, powder additives are incorporated into polymers to enhance their thermal conductivity, allowing for better heat dissipation in electronic devices. Similarly, in the cosmetics industry, powder additives are used in formulations to modify the texture, color, and opacity of products, creating unique and appealing cosmetic formulations.
The versatility of powder additives makes them an essential component in various industries, enabling manufacturers to customize materials according to their specific requirements. Whether it is improving strength, durability, resistance to environmental factors, or enhancing performance in specific applications, powder additives offer endless possibilities for innovation and optimization.
Despite their numerous benefits, the selection and use of powder additives require careful consideration to ensure optimal performance and compatibility with base materials. Factors such as particle size, concentration, and compatibility with the base material must be taken into account when incorporating powder additives into formulations. Additionally, proper mixing and dispersion techniques are essential to ensure uniform distribution of the additives throughout the material.
Furthermore, manufacturers must also consider the environmental impact of using powder additives and ensure that they comply with regulations and standards for safety and sustainability. By choosing eco-friendly additives and adopting green practices, companies can minimize their environmental footprint and contribute to a more sustainable future.
